- Subject: problem with /dev/dsp
I used to be able to copy WAV files to /dev/dsp, they would play,
and I would know what was happening in my scripts. Now I get a
silent error message.
$ /bin/cp bin/alert.wav /dev/dsp
cp: writing `/dev/dsp': No space left on device
cp: failed to extend `/dev/dsp': No space left on device
$ cat bin/alert.wav > /dev/dsp
cat: write error: No space left on device
$ cat bin/alert.wav >> /dev/dsp
cat: write error: No space left on device
echo '^G' works fine.
Everything up to date. Seems correlated with the new cygwin1.dll.
